更新時(shí)間:2021-05-10 來(lái)源:黑馬程序員 瀏覽量:
首先Web前端開(kāi)發(fā)網(wǎng)頁(yè)主要由HTML、CSS、JavaScript三大要素組成。隨著企業(yè)需求來(lái)變化,前端開(kāi)發(fā)技術(shù)的三要素也演變成現(xiàn)今的HTML5、CSS3、jQuery。響應(yīng)式布局、微網(wǎng)站等是Web前端未來(lái)的發(fā)展方向之一。
具體說(shuō)到網(wǎng)站前端開(kāi)發(fā)基礎(chǔ)知識(shí)學(xué)習(xí)內(nèi)容有:
1.HTML基礎(chǔ)標(biāo)簽
HTML不管前后端,是必須要會(huì)的基礎(chǔ)中的基礎(chǔ)。HTML標(biāo)簽常用的也沒(méi)幾個(gè),學(xué)起來(lái)其實(shí)很容易。HTML的學(xué)習(xí)是一個(gè)記憶和理解的過(guò)程,在學(xué)習(xí)過(guò)程中可以借助Dreamweaver的“拆分”視圖輔助學(xué)習(xí)。
2.CSS樣式
用于美化網(wǎng)頁(yè)用的,它需要結(jié)合前面的HTML標(biāo)簽才能發(fā)揮其用處。稍比HTML標(biāo)簽難學(xué)一點(diǎn)點(diǎn),需要新手朋友不斷的練習(xí)來(lái)掌握它。
相對(duì)于傳統(tǒng)HTML的表現(xiàn)而言,CSS樣式是可以復(fù)用的,這樣就極大地提高了開(kāi)發(fā)的速度,降低了維護(hù)的成本。同時(shí)CSS中的盒子模型、相對(duì)布局、絕對(duì)布局等能夠?qū)崿F(xiàn)對(duì)網(wǎng)頁(yè)中各對(duì)象的位置排版進(jìn)行像素級(jí)的精確控制。
3.JavaScript
一種直譯式腳本語(yǔ)言,是一種動(dòng)態(tài)類型、弱類型、基于原型的語(yǔ)言,內(nèi)置支持類型。被廣泛用于Web應(yīng)用開(kāi)發(fā),常用來(lái)為網(wǎng)頁(yè)添加各式各樣的動(dòng)態(tài)功能,為用戶提供更流暢美觀的瀏覽效果。
4.jQueryjQuery
一個(gè)快速、簡(jiǎn)潔的JavaScript框架,它封裝JavaScript常用的功能代碼,提供一種簡(jiǎn)便的JavaScript設(shè)計(jì)模式,優(yōu)化HTML文檔操作、事件處理、動(dòng)畫(huà)設(shè)計(jì)和Ajax交互。
可以簡(jiǎn)單理解為,HTML定義了網(wǎng)頁(yè)的內(nèi)容,CSS裝飾了網(wǎng)頁(yè)的布局,JavaScript網(wǎng)頁(yè)的行為,jQuery是一個(gè)JavaScript庫(kù)。
5.簡(jiǎn)單的PS操作
對(duì)于一個(gè)網(wǎng)站而言少不了需要一些圖片來(lái)裝飾網(wǎng)站,讓網(wǎng)站看起來(lái)更美觀。
基礎(chǔ)階段熟練掌握HTML、CSS、JS等基礎(chǔ)必不可少,進(jìn)階階段要掌握VUE、React、Angular等框架應(yīng)用。
對(duì)常用的JS框架進(jìn)行深入理解,如jQuery、YUI等;
掌握基本的JavaScript計(jì)算方法編寫(xiě);
對(duì)目前互聯(lián)網(wǎng)流行的網(wǎng)頁(yè)制作方法HTML+CSS,以及各大瀏覽器兼容性有很大的了解;
對(duì)前沿技術(shù)(HTML5+CSS3)的基本掌握;
還要對(duì)IT其他編程語(yǔ)言有所了解如:PHP,Java;
還要懂SEO優(yōu)化;
...
學(xué)習(xí)前端大致就是需要掌握這些內(nèi)容,這里給你提供一個(gè)學(xué)習(xí)路線圖,你也可以對(duì)照上面的知識(shí)點(diǎn)來(lái)進(jìn)行技能歸類和學(xué)習(xí):
猜你喜歡:
網(wǎng)頁(yè)前端開(kāi)發(fā)工具有哪些?